At the January meeting, the Federal Open Market <br />Committee (FOMC) decided to keep rates unchanged. Currently, the consensus is for two more rate hikes <br />in 2016, ending theyear near 1 % for the Fed Fund Rate.While staff continues to monitor rates and <br />economic conditions,the strategy for the portfolio will,as always,focus on ladderingto pick up yield along <br />the curve and maintaininga constant cash flow and liquid position. <br />2 <br /> <br />
